Gray Hair Causes


by Arnulfo Cocke

During our lives, both ladies and men will experience the on pair of Gray Hair. Contrary to everyday opinion it's not always associated with one's age. Grey hair can occur who are only in our adolescents and range directly into our late 50's and even older.

Everybody is different though the pigment of the hair is generated in the same manner. The cells our follicles called "Melanocytes" generate pigments the main one being Melanin. This provides you with it its "Color". When these Melanocytes cease producing the pigment the end result is a translucent hair. This against the healthier darker hair increases the appearance of Grey. In reality definitely not Grey but see-thorugh.

The main basis for our hair behaving using this method is heredity. If your mother or dad started off going Gray with a young age then the then chances are you may also experience premature Gray tresses. This is not necessarily the case. Age does play a big part in your graying process. The pigment within the hair shaft is generated from cells at the base of the root of the hair and as we get more aged these cells start producing less pigment until there is absolutely no pigment at most and we end up receiving the transparent head of hair.

Grey hair may also be the result of your medical condition. For anyone who is deficient in B12 or have problems with a thyroid imbalance it may also cause your hair to visit Gray.

The sudden look of Grey seriously isn't due to subconscious shock or tension. Studies have shown that in case this does happen then it's typically due to Alopecia areata. What the results are here is which the thicker, darker curly hair stop growing before it effects the particular growth of grey hairs, giving your impression of Dull overnight. Alopecia areata gradually causes round designed patches of hairloss or complete baldness.
